Based in the Twin Cities of Minneapolis and St. Paul, Minnesota, Allina Health is a not-for-profit 501(c)(3) organization, with 90+ clinics, 10 hospitals/13 campuses throughout the region including western Wisconsin. Allina Health operates in one of the nation’s most vibrant, livable areas; a place where you can build the career you want—and you and your family can be part of a thriving community.

Allina Health has a robust Mental Health and Addiction Clinical Service Line that offers the full continuum of care including integration, specialty outpatient clinics, addiction, co-occurring services, partial hospitalization, day treatment, emergency, and inpatient care.

Job Description:

  • Assess patients for appropriateness for level of care and their specific program
  • Provides direct clinical care in psychiatry, including brief assessments and interventions.
  • In collaboration with treatment team, patient and family, develop behaviorally-focused, outcomes-based treatment plans of care that address mental health, functional impairment, social and emotional needs, and/or medical disorders.
  • Work with program RN on addressing and collaborating with outpatient providers on comorbid medical issues in our patient population.
  • Actively participates in multidisciplinary team approach to case management.
  • May provide care in an ambulatory clinic, inpatient or outpatient hospital setting.
  • Participate in on-call rotation.
  • Develops and lead staff education in psychiatric issues.

Job Requirements

  • MD, DO, or foreign equivalency training required
  • BE/BC with ABMS or AOA required
  • Active, non-restricted medical license in MN (or ability to obtain)
  • Ability to obtain and/or maintain MN DEA certification and National Provider Identifier (NPI)
  • Ability to meet criteria/qualifications for Credentialing and hospital privileges, if applicable
